VMEbus packs multiprocessing power

VMEbus is on the move. With support from more than 300 board vendors, the bus continues to add a formidable array of powerful products aimed at high-throughput, fast-I/O, multiprocessing and real-time industrial-control tasks. In fact, the capabilities of these integrated boards and software center on certain key areas: A slew of 32-bit-processor-based boards with clock speeds up to 25 MHz; Zero wait-state access up to 4M bytes of on-board, dual-ported RAM; Multiple high-speed intelligent I/O channels; A variety of multitasking, multiuser and real-time operating systems; Data and/or instruction caches and high-speed local buses for fast memory access; Integrated math coprocessors and memory-management chips; and Fast signal-processing boards. This article discusses some of the products that are available.
